GridViewRowCollection.Count Egenskap

Hämtar antalet objekt i objektet GridViewRowCollection .
public:
property int Count { int get(); };
public int Count { get; }
member this.Count : int
Public ReadOnly Property Count As Integer
Egenskapsvärde
Antalet objekt i GridViewRowCollection objektet.

Exempel
I följande exempel visas hur du använder Count egenskapen för att avgöra om GridView kontrollen innehåller några poster. Ett värde som är större än noll anger att GridView kontrollen innehåller minst en post.
<%@ Page language="C#" %>
<!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Transitional//EN"
"http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-transitional.dtd">
<script runat="server">
void AuthorsGridView_RowCreated(Object sender, GridViewRowEventArgs e)
{
if (e.Row.RowType == DataControlRowType.Footer)
{
// Get the number of items in the Rows collection.
int count = AuthorsGridView.Rows.Count;
// If the GridView control contains any records, display
// the last name of each author in the GridView control.
if (count > 0)
{
Message.Text = "The authors are:<br />";
foreach (GridViewRow row in AuthorsGridView.Rows)
{
Message.Text += row.Cells[0].Text + "<br />";
}
}
}
}
</script>
<html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" >
<head runat="server">
<title>GridViewRowCollection Example</title>
</head>
<body>
<form id="form1" runat="server">
<h3>GridViewRowCollection Example</h3>
<table>
<tr>
<td>
<asp:gridview id="AuthorsGridView"
datasourceid="AuthorsSqlDataSource"
autogeneratecolumns="false"
onrowcreated="AuthorsGridView_RowCreated"
runat="server">
<columns>
<asp:boundfield datafield="au_lname"
headertext="Last Name"/>
<asp:boundfield datafield="au_fname"
headertext="First Name"/>
</columns>
</asp:gridview>
</td>
<td>
<asp:label id="Message"
forecolor="Red"
runat="server"/>
</td>
</tr>
</table>
<!-- This example uses Microsoft SQL Server and connects -->
<!-- to the Pubs sample database. -->
<asp:sqldatasource id="AuthorsSqlDataSource"
selectcommand="SELECT [au_lname], [au_fname] FROM [authors] WHERE [state]='CA'"
connectionstring="server=localhost;database=pubs;integrated security=SSPI"
runat="server">
</asp:sqldatasource>
</form>
</body>
</html>

Kommentarer
Använd egenskapen Count för att fastställa antalet objekt i samlingen. Egenskapen Count används ofta när du itererar genom samlingen för att fastställa samlingens övre gräns. Egenskapen Count används också ofta för att avgöra om en samling är tom.
